In this latest VMblog Expert Interview Series, we spoke with Scott Anderson, SVP of Product Management and Business Operations at Couchbase. This week, the company launched Couchbase Cloud, its award-winning, fully-managed Database-as-a-Service (DBaaS). Couchbase Cloud is initially available on Amazon Web Services (AWS) with support for Microsoft Azure and Google Cloud Platform available by year-end.

The quickly-evolving economy is accelerating digital transformation in almost every organization, bringing equal parts opportunity and cost control pressure to IT. Listen as Scott Anderson provides more detail.

Couchbase Cloud made its debut on AWS this week, and is available immediately as a 30-day trial, which runs inside the customer’s AWS account. It is offered in two packages, Developer Pro and Enterprise, which offer differentiated service level guarantees for development and testing needs versus business-critical support for production systems.
